Halsey is a unique name that carries a deep history, originating from English culture. It means "from Hal's island, " connecting to the heathlands of England. Initially used as a surname, it has evolved into a given name, particularly popularized by the American singer and songwriter Ashley Nicolette Frangipane, known professionally as Halsey. This name has transitioned from being predominantly feminine to being used for both genders. Its usage as a given name is a modern phenomenon, reflecting the evolving nature of naming conventions.
